I am new to Modicon PLCs.

I have learned how to place Function Blocks (FFB) on a Function Block Diagram (FBD), but I cannot for the life of me figure out how to connect variables to that Block.

Anyone with some Concept help would probably know.

I have looked throught the Help Files, but I cannot find anything.

Thanks for any help in advance.
 
Doh, I figured it out.

Doh, I figured it out.

All I had to do was double left-click on the leg of the FFB.
